What Types of Work and Facilities Can Echo Sonographers Expect in Northampton, MA?

As a Sonographer specializing in echocardiography in Northampton, Massachusetts, you can expect to find diverse and rewarding opportunities across various healthcare settings, including hospitals, outpatient clinics, and specialized cardiac care facilities. In these environments, you will utilize advanced ultrasound technology to perform comprehensive echocardiograms, assess heart function, and assist in the diagnosis of cardiovascular conditions. Additionally, you may collaborate closely with cardiologists and other healthcare professionals to interpret findings, develop patient care plans, and contribute to multidisciplinary teams aimed at enhancing patient outcomes. A typical day in this role includes performing adult transthoracic echocardiograms for a mix of outpatient and referred patients, as well as studies for inpatients when needed. Examinations range from routine evaluations of cardiac function to more complex assessments for cardiomyopathies, valvular heart disease, ischemic heart disease, and pre- and post-intervention follow-up. You will be responsible for acquiring diagnostic-quality images, making appropriate measurements, and ensuring complete and accurate documentation within the EMR and imaging systems. You will also assist with urgent or time-sensitive studies, promptly identifying and communicating critical findings to the cardiology team. Patient interaction is a central part of this position. You will explain procedures, address questions, and help put patients at ease while maintaining professionalism and compassion. The environment supports reasonable patient volumes and time allotments so that you can focus on both image quality and patient experience. You will follow established protocols for infection prevention, equipment care, and exam room preparation, and you will contribute to quality initiatives aimed at maintaining high standards across the cardiac imaging service. Purpose of Position Under the supervision of the Cardiologist’s, and following established technical standards, provides Echocardiography ultrasound images of the heart and related structures of adult and geriatric patients for Cardiologist interpretation. Performs 2-D, M-Mode, Pulse/Continuous Wave Color Doppler Capable of writing preliminary interpretation. Performs emergency studies as required. Maintains echo lab records and patient charges. Participates in the activities required to maintain echocardiography changes and updates. Fulfills the educational requirements of the clinic and all accreditation and licensing agencies governing the delivery of care. This includes, but is not limited to, current CPR certification and attendance at mandatory office in-services.
